The Art Club is an honorary organization in that one must receive a semester “A” in art before he may become a member. The officers are the members with the largest number of semester “A’s.” Each year in the spring the seniors in the organization give a private exhibit of both paintings in various mediums and of ceramic work. These exhibits are displayed in down town windows. PEP CLUB The Pep Club, open to any Sophomore, Junior, or Senior girl who wants to promote school spirit, was formed this year. The girls learn special cheers to perform at games and pep assemblies. Their outfits are white blouses and dark skirts. Each girl should have a blue and a yellow pom-pom. These girls have added much to our games by their enthusiasm. FUTURE HOMEMAKERS The Future Homemakers of America is the national organization of pupils studying homemaking in junior and senior high schools of the United States and territories. The Sheridan Chapter is made up of approximately 40 members, whose primary goal is individual selfbetterment. This is accomplished through active participation in all F. H. A. programs.
